10 Actionable Strategies to Fuel Business Growth
Here are 10 simple but powerful Business Growth ideas that can help speed up your business growth this year:
1. Double Down on What’s Already Working
Before chasing the next big thing, ask yourself: What’s already bringing results?
Focus on your best-performing product, platform, or marketing channel. Drop the things that waste time or bring low results.
Example: If Instagram drives sales, create more content there instead of trying every platform.
2. Make Customers Feel Important
Everyone is giving services or products to their customer. So, what do you offer them extra? Only providing products or services to customers is not enough; go beyond to solve customer queries, respond to their feedback, and show appreciation towards your customers. These small actions create a connection and boost customer loyalty
Tip: Send a thank-you message or offer a small bonus to returning customers. Small gestures build loyalty.
3. Strengthen Your Online Presence
In today’s world, all people are busy scrolling Instagram, etc, and Meta itself has a large audience with lots of information about its users, so it’s easier for you to target your ideal customer as per your product or services. If you’re good at presenting yourself online, you won’t just compete—you’ll stand out and dominate your market.
Checklist:
- Basic website
- Google My Business listing
- Updated social media accounts
- Positive customer reviews
4. Use AI to Save Time and Get More Done
Learning how to use AI tools can significantly boost your efficiency. You can reduce your workload and costs. This process will help you make more profit, like for content writing, emails, etc. There are lots of tools available to help.
Try tools like:
- ChatGPT for writing
- Canva AI for design
- Notion AI for organizing ideas
- Mailchimp for email automation
5. Collaborate to Grow Together
Partner with other brands or creators who share your audience but don’t directly compete with you. Cross-promotion can help you to reach a new audience and open up new markets without extra cost.
Example: A skincare brand can partner with a wellness influencer to launch a giveaway and grow both audiences.
6. Share Helpful, Valuable Content
Educate, entertain, or inspire your audience with content that matters. Start a blog, post how-to videos, or share useful tips on social media.
Why it works: When people get free value from you, they’re more likely to trust you and eventually buy from you.
7. Launch Something New
Keep your audience curious and excited. A new product, a seasonal offer, or even a limited-edition version of an existing item, launching something new can boost excitement and sales.
Tip: Ask your audience what they’d love to see next—you’ll get ideas straight from the people who matter.
8. Don’t Forget Existing Customers
Acquiring new customers is great, but keeping your old ones is even better (and more cost-effective). Focus on building long-term relationships, not just making sales.
How:
- Offer loyalty discounts
- Start a referral program
- Send personalized offers or check-ins
9. Learn Something New Every Week
Markets change fast. Staying updated with trends, tools, and customer behavior helps you make smarter decisions and stay ahead of the competition.
Easy ways:
- Follow business podcasts or blogs
- Take short online courses
- Read case studies of successful brands
10. Show Confidence in Your Brand
When you believe in what you’re selling, others will too. Be confident, consistent, and real. Share your story, your “why,” and your journey that got you here.
Why it matters: People don’t just buy products—they buy trust, passion, and connection.
